Buyers demand clear, well-organized financial books. Your business coach will assist in streamlining accounts, highlighting profitability, and compiling comprehensive financial records. This transparency builds buyer trust and accelerates the sales process.
A strong business operates efficiently, even without your daily involvement. Coaches help build strong teams, document key processes, and reduce your hands-on role. This demonstrates low operational risk and high value to potential buyers.
From contracts to licenses, a coach thoroughly reviews all necessary legal documentation. They help identify and rectify any deficiencies before they become problems, ensuring buyers feel secure in their investment.
Valuing your business involves more than just yearly profit. Hiring Peter as your business sales coach helps you identify all the contributing factors, such as growth potential, skilled staff, loyal customers, consistent cash flow, and your unique market position. They’ll benchmark your business against similar market transactions to ensure your asking price is justified and supports a strong sale.
To arrive at this fair price, Peter utilizes several valuation methods. These might include analyzing earnings multiples, assessing asset values, or comparing your business to similar companies in the market. By blending these approaches, he will establish a credible and transparent valuation that instills buyer confidence.
The final valuation is significantly impacted by factors like stable recurring income, a robust customer base, a strong management team, and your position in a growing market. Peter as your coach will guide you on how to enhance these key elements that buyers value most, ultimately increasing your business’s appeal and worth.

A broker is mostly focused on finding prospective buyers and closing quickly. A business coach helps you build the business’s value before you sell. Coaches support you more fully, while brokers focus on the technical sale.
It’s best to strengthen your team so they can handle their work without you. Some owners wait to share sale news until a deal is close, to limit stress. With good systems, the change goes more smoothly for both staff and buyer.
Setting the wrong price, messy records, and letting emotions get in the way are common mistakes. Trying to sell without help also leads to problems. Most troubles can be avoided with a coach’s planning and honest advice.
